One of the primary concerns with platforms like HDHub4u is the issue of copyright infringement. The movies and web series available on these sites are often hosted without the permission of the copyright holders. Downloading or streaming copyrighted content without authorization is illegal and can expose users to legal consequences, including fines and potential lawsuits. Furthermore, the legality of these platforms varies by jurisdiction, adding another layer of complexity for users.
Beyond the legal risks, the use of platforms like HDHub4u poses significant threats to your digital security. These sites are often riddled with malware, viruses, and other malicious software that can infect your device when you click on links, download files, or even simply visit the website. This malware can steal your personal information, including passwords, banking details, and browsing history, potentially leading to identity theft, financial fraud, and other serious security breaches.
The deceptive nature of these platforms often involves intrusive advertisements, pop-ups, and redirects. These elements can be incredibly frustrating and can also be designed to trick users into clicking on malicious links or downloading harmful software. These advertisements may also track your online activity and collect your personal data for targeted advertising purposes, raising concerns about privacy.

When considering alternatives to platforms like HDHub4u, it's essential to prioritize legal and safe options. Subscription-based streaming services, such as Netflix, Amazon Prime Video, and Disney+, offer access to a vast library of movies and web series, along with a superior viewing experience. These services provide high-quality content, are free of malware and advertisements, and adhere to copyright laws, providing peace of mind.
Another option is to rent or purchase movies from legitimate digital retailers like Apple iTunes, Google Play Movies & TV, or Amazon Prime Video. This ensures that you are accessing the content legally and supporting the filmmakers and studios involved.
Public libraries also offer a wealth of free entertainment options, including DVDs and Blu-rays. This is a safe and convenient way to access movies and web series without the risks associated with illegal streaming and downloading.
If you are looking for free and legal streaming options, consider platforms like Tubi, Crackle, and The Roku Channel. These services offer a selection of movies and web series, supported by advertising. While you may encounter advertisements, these platforms are safe and provide a legitimate way to access content.
Protecting yourself online is a crucial aspect of using the internet safely. Ensure that your devices have up-to-date antivirus software installed. Avoid clicking on suspicious links or downloading files from unknown sources. Use strong, unique passwords for all your accounts and consider using a password manager. Enable two-factor authentication whenever possible.
Be cautious about the information you share online. Avoid sharing sensitive personal information on websites or social media platforms. Review the privacy settings on your social media accounts to control who can see your posts and personal data.
If you suspect your device has been infected with malware, take immediate action. Run a full scan with your antivirus software. If the problem persists, consider seeking help from a qualified IT professional.
